1. What is a distribution services agreement? | A distribution services agreement is a legally binding contract between a supplier and a distributor, outlining the terms and conditions of the distribution of goods or services. It establishes rights obligations parties governs relationship. |
2. What are the key elements of a distribution services agreement? | Key elements Distribution Services Agreement include scope distribution, territorial rights, Pricing and Payment Terms, duration agreement, termination clauses, intellectual property rights. |

What are the differences between an exclusive and non-exclusive distribution services agreement? | An exclusive distribution services agreement grants a single distributor the exclusive right to distribute the supplier`s products within a specified territory, while a non-exclusive agreement allows the supplier to engage multiple distributors within the same territory. |

One of the key aspects of distribution services agreements is the allocation of rights and responsibilities between the parties involved. These agreements often include provisions related to pricing, marketing, and sales targets, as well as terms governing the termination and renewal of the agreement. The negotiation of these terms requires a delicate balance between protecting the interests of the parties while also fostering a mutually beneficial business relationship.

Key Components of a Distribution Services Agreement
Let`s take closer look Key Components of a Distribution Services Agreement:
Component | Description |
---|---|
Pricing and Payment Terms | Specifies pricing structure products services distributed, terms payment invoicing. |
Marketing Promotion | Outlines the marketing and promotional activities to be undertaken by the distributor, including any co-op advertising arrangements. |
Sales Targets and Performance Metrics | Establishes Sales Targets and Performance Metrics distributor expected meet, incentives penalties achievement non-achievement. |
Term Termination | Sets forth the duration of the agreement, as well as the grounds and procedures for termination or renewal. |
